Job Description At Airbnb, we are building the best in-house culinary team in the world and we are seeking a General Manager to lead service. Here in our global headquarters, we provide all aspects of service including restaurants, cafeterias, break rooms, catering, room service, boardroom setup, pop-up’s, and events. Working hand in hand with our executive chef, the General Manager will create an unparalleled service atmosphere focused on empowerment, growth, urgency, and respect.

Airbnb is a global hospitality brand, and our internal food team is the heart of our company's hospitality.  You will be a full time employee of Airbnb, not a subcontractor, and we are looking for someone who is entrepreneurial and passionate about our mission of creating a world where anyone can belong anywhere, one experience at a time.  A strong candidate is an excellent communicator, a collaborative leader who posses a strong vision that inspires their team, and connects to Airbnb’s mission.Of course, you'll also do important General Manager duties like create the schedule, maintain food safety compliance, plan and help execute numerous special requests, get your hands dirty, and solve problems every day.  We are seeking a hands-on manager who can be a resource to the global food program and a leader for the local service team, and an asset to the company as a whole.Responsibilities
